ddhp

Density derivative by specific enthalpy

Syntax

ddhp = ddhp(p, h, phase, region)

Inputs (4)

p

Type: Pressure (Pa)

Description: Pressure

h

Type: SpecificEnthalpy (J/kg)

Description: Specific enthalpy

phase

Default Value: 0

Type: Integer

Description: 2 for two-phase, 1 for one-phase, 0 if not known

region

Default Value: 0

Type: Integer

Description: If 0, region is unknown, otherwise known and this input

Outputs (1)

ddhp

Type: DerDensityByEnthalpy (kg⋅s²/m⁵)

Description: Density derivative by specific enthalpy
